This ceramic capacitor is a surface mount multilayer ceramic capacitor (MLCC) with a capacitance of 82 pF, rated voltage of 50V DC, and tolerance of ±1%. It employs C0G (NP0) dielectric, which is a Class I ceramic material known for its stable capacitance over temperature, with a temperature coefficient of 0 ±30 ppm/°C over the operating temperature range of -55°C to +125°C. The capacitance change is less than ±0.3% over this range, making it suitable for precision timing and filtering applications.
The component is housed in an 0603 (1608 Metric) package with dimensions 1.60mm x 0.81mm and a maximum thickness of 0.90mm. It is designed for surface mount technology (SMT) assembly and is supplied on 7-inch reels for automated pick-and-place. Terminations are plated with nickel and tin, ensuring good solderability and reliability.
As a C0G NP0 capacitor, it offers low capacitance drift and high Q factor, making it ideal for resonant circuits, filters, and coupling applications where stability is critical. The part is RoHS3 compliant (unverified) and has an MSL of 1 (unlimited floor life), suitable for most manufacturing environments.
